Kintsugi Psychiatry, Llc - Medicare Mental Health Clinic in Casper, WY

Kintsugi Psychiatry, Llc is a medicare enrolled mental health clinic (Nurse Practitioner - Psychiatric/mental Health) in Casper, Wyoming. The current practice location for Kintsugi Psychiatry, Llc is 145 S Durbin St Ste 108, Casper, Wyoming. For appointments, you can reach them via phone at (307) 333-5757. The mailing address for Kintsugi Psychiatry, Llc is Po Box 1117, Casper, Wyoming and phone number is (307) 333-5757.

Kintsugi Psychiatry, Llc is licensed to practice in * (Not Available) (license number ). The clinic also participates in the medicare program and its NPI number is 1306406509. This medical practice accepts medicare insurance (which means this clinic accepts the Medicare-approved amount; you will not be billed for any more than the Medicare deductible and coinsurance). However, please confirm if they accept your insurance at (307) 333-5757.
